Some ARM loans give you the option of converting your loan from an ARM to a fixed rate loan. This opportunity is usually only available for a limited period of time. If the loan is not converted to a fixed rate during this time period, the interest rate will continue to adjust for the life of the loan. Please refer to your loan agreement to determine whether or not your loan contains a conversion option. If it does, the loan documents will specify when this option is available, and how the conversion rate is calculated. Attorney/Closing Agent The attorney or closing agent is responsible for ensuring that all documents have been completed properly including those related to the title search and title insurance. The closing agent will explain all closing documents to you and the seller, obtain your signatures, and record the documents with the appropriate local governments. He or she also will collect the transaction fees and give them to the appropriate parties. Normally, PMI may be removed if you have reduced the principal amount of your loan to 80% or lower than the original purchase price. It also may be removed if you have obtained an independent appraisal stating that the outstanding principal amount of the loan is 80% or lower than the appraised value. Some lenders do not require PMI. Instead, they may increase their origination fee and/or the interest rate on the loan. This can represent a significant advantage to the borrower since PMI premiums are not deductible for tax purposes and mortgage interest is usually deductible.
